2015 Spectacle Island Vascular Plant Botanical Inventory Washington County, Eastport, Maine, United States.Spectacle Island (CIR 79-132)in Cobscook Bay, north of Lubec, Maine. Inventory Conducted: AUGUST 19, 2015; September 18, 2015 Maine Natural History ObservatoryLead Botanist: Glen MittelhauserContact: info@mainenaturalhistory.orgFunding Sources: Maine Coastal Islands National Wildlife Refuge -----------------------------Permissions and Data Use These data are made publicly available to encourage transparency, long-term preservation, and reuse in ecological research, conservation planning, and education. Users are encouraged, though not required, to notify Maine Natural History Observatory of substantial or interpretive uses of the dataset, particularly those leading to publication. -----------------------------File list and description of each file 1) Core fileFile Name: SpectacleIsland2015_EventCore_GridCells.csv Description: Using GIS software, we built a 30x30 m grid across the island and into the intertidal zone. The grid was oriented following true compass bearings, with the UTM coordinates (NAD83, Zone 19). This file contains coordinates only for the grid cells that contained vascular plants. GRID CELLS2) Extension of Core fileFile Name: SpectacleIsland2015_Occurrences_GridCells.csv Connects to: SpectacleIsland2015_EventCore_GridCells.csv linked using the gridCell column. Description: In the field, we referred to the GPS unit to determine the bounds of each grid cell. On each trip to the island, we made a list of vascular plants present within each grid cell and estimated the categorical abundance of each. Abundance categories were as follows: common = species with a wide distribution in the grid cell, occurring in large numbers; occasional = species with a scattered distribution throughout the grid cell; uncommon = species not widely distributed and not often encountered in the grid cell; and rare = species usually restricted to small areas, specialized habitats, or consisting of 1 or 2 very small "populations" in the grid cell. -----------------------------Column Definitions Name: gridCell Type: IntegerDescription: Identifier for the 30x30 m grid cells.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: eventID (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/eventID) Name: verbatimCoordinateSystem Type: StringDescription: The coordinate format for the location.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: verbatimCoordinateSystem (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/verbatimCoordinateSystem) Name: UTMx(Easting) Type: DoubleDescription: UTM X coordinate.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: Name: UTMy(Northing) Type: DoubleDescription: UTM Y coordinate.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: Name: geodeticDatum Type: StringDescription: The geodetic datum upon which the geographic coordinates given are based.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: geodeticDatum (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/geodeticDatum) Name: UTMZone Type: StringDescription: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: Name: year Type: IntegerDescription: The four-digit year in which the survey occurred.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: year (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/year) Name: samplingProtocol Type: StringDescription: The names of, references to, or descriptions of the methods or protocols of event.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: samplingProtocol (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/samplingProtocol) Name: island Type: StringDescription: The name of the island on which the location occurs.Maps to term(s) in Darwin Core: island (http://rs.tdwg.org/dwc/terms/island) Name: scientificName Type: StringDescription: The full scientific name, with authorship and date information if known.
